The Wide-Ranging Effects of Crop Damage

When we talk about effects of crop damage, one of the most immediate and impactful is the potential for food prices to increase. Think about it: if a large portion of a particular crop is damaged due to pests, disease, extreme weather, or any other factor, the supply of that food item naturally decreases. Basic economics tells us that when supply goes down and demand stays the same (or even increases!), prices tend to shoot up. This isn't just a minor inconvenience; for many families, it can mean the difference between affording nutritious meals and struggling to put food on the table. We're talking about staples like grains, fruits, and vegetables becoming more expensive, which disproportionately affects lower-income households. Furthermore, this price volatility can make it harder for businesses that rely on these crops, like restaurants and food manufacturers, to manage their costs, potentially leading to higher prices for their products as well. It's a domino effect that starts in the fields and ends up in your grocery basket. The unpredictability of crop yields due to damage also makes long-term planning difficult for governments and aid organizations, especially in regions prone to food insecurity. Ensuring a stable and affordable food supply is a cornerstone of societal well-being, and crop damage directly undermines this stability. Understanding the Causes of Crop Damage

Before we delve deeper into the consequences, let's quickly touch upon what causes this dreaded crop damage in the first place. It's a multifaceted problem, guys. Climate change is a huge player here, bringing us more frequent and intense extreme weather events like droughts, floods, heatwaves, and unseasonal frosts. These aren't just minor weather fluctuations; they can devastate entire harvests. Imagine crops wilting under a scorching sun or being washed away by sudden deluges – it’s a harsh reality for farmers. Then there are pests and diseases. Tiny insects or microscopic fungi might seem insignificant, but they can multiply rapidly and decimate crops if not managed properly. Think of locust swarms or new strains of plant viruses that spread like wildfire. Poor agricultural practices also contribute. This can include things like inadequate soil management, lack of crop rotation, and improper use of pesticides or fertilizers. If the soil isn't healthy, it can't support strong, resilient crops. Natural disasters like hurricanes, typhoons, and wildfires, often exacerbated by climate change, can physically destroy crops and farmland in a matter of hours. Even human factors like pollution can negatively impact crop health. It’s a whole ecosystem of potential problems that can lead to significant crop loss. Beyond Prices: Other Critical Effects of Crop Damage

While increased food prices are a major concern, the effects of crop damage extend far beyond our wallets. Another significant issue is the spread of diseases. When crops are damaged, they often become more susceptible to pathogens. Furthermore, damaged crops, especially those affected by floods or contaminated water, can become a breeding ground for bacteria and viruses. If these contaminated crops enter the food chain, they can pose serious health risks to consumers. Imagine consuming vegetables that have been submerged in floodwaters potentially mixed with waste from sewers. This is a horrifying scenario that can lead to widespread foodborne illnesses like E. coli or Salmonella infections. It’s not just about the crops themselves; the entire agricultural environment can become compromised. Moreover, damaged crops can attract pests that carry diseases, further complicating the situation. Beyond direct consumption, the economic strain from crop damage can also impact public health infrastructure. When food security is threatened, governments may need to divert resources towards emergency food aid, potentially taking away from essential healthcare services. In regions already struggling with poverty and malnutrition, widespread crop failure can exacerbate existing health problems and make populations more vulnerable to outbreaks of disease. The sanitation aspect is particularly grim; contaminated water sources from floods can spread waterborne diseases like cholera, and if agricultural land is flooded with such water, crops grown there can become vectors for these illnesses. The Far-Reaching Consequences for Food Security

Ultimately, the most profound of the effects of crop damage is the threat it poses to food security. Food security means that all people, at all times, have physical, social, and economic access to sufficient, safe, and nutritious food that meets their dietary needs and food preferences for an active and healthy life. When crops are extensively damaged, this fundamental human right is jeopardized. Large-scale crop failures can lead to food shortages, particularly in regions that are already vulnerable or heavily reliant on specific crops. In severe cases, widespread crop damage can lead to famine, displacement of populations, and social unrest. We see this in history and unfortunately, in current events, where prolonged drought or devastating floods have wiped out harvests, forcing people to abandon their homes in search of sustenance. The economic impact also exacerbates food insecurity. Farmers lose their income, communities dependent on agriculture suffer, and national economies can be destabilized. This makes it harder for governments to import food or provide aid. The cycle of poverty can be intensified as farmers are unable to replant or recover, leading to generational impacts.
